The IDPA category appears to be a concession for folks who don't want to upgrade to Limited standards for the match, and don't want to feel "disadvantaged".  
I don't think that's the case, Rob. CDP, ESP and SSP are recognized as are Cowboy divisions. They are sponsored and have prizes and cash awards for 1st, 2nd & 3rd. Open and Limited are the realm of race gear, both guns and ghost holsters. ISI Shootists, who ran the Steel Challenge for years and made it the richest prize match today long before they sold the rights to USPSA, also hold IDPA matches, not USPSA matches at their facility.

Taran Butler has competed and won in ESP at the Steel Challenge the last several years. I don't think he feels disadvantaged or in need of a concession anywhere he shoots.
